Subject: Font vendoring cut-over complete

Team,

As of this week, Brightquill no longer fetches display fonts from the Typemarsh CDN at build time. All licensed families are vendored under assets/fonts and checked into the repo. The fetch step was removed from the pipeline, and the fallback logic is gone. The values the renderer now reads at startup are as follows.

settings of tagef-bawif:
DRUIX_HOST=druix.zemvarlabs.internal
DRUIX_PORT=8000

Ticket: config drift — Tracehollow tracing stack. Spans from the billing and ledger services stopped joining last week. Root cause: someone hand-edited the collector on node pool B, so sampling rates diverged from the repo. Fix is to reapply the canonical settings everywhere. Every collector must run with the following configuration values.

config for kafof-bawef:
holath:
  log_level: debug
  metrics_host: metrics.holath.qorvelsys.internal
  pin: 2191
  pool_size: 32

The nightly reindex job on the Ostermead cluster has been failing silently since the last rotation because /srv/quillsearch/indexer.env was restored from an outdated backup. Non-sensitive settings (INDEX_SHARDS, CRAWL_DEPTH, REINDEX_HOUR) were verified correct and left in place. The stale entry granting write access to the index store was removed per policy, since it appeared in a world-readable backup. Security review requested before we restore access. The replacement credential line should be appended directly below this sentence.

secret setting of yagef-baweg: RELAY_SECRET29=cb53deb59a49ed54d9f43599b54ca

// REINDEX_BATCH_CAP limits docs per shard pass in the Tallowfield
// nightly search reindex. Raising it starves the ingest queue;
// lowering it overruns the maintenance window. 5000 is the tested
// sweet spot. Change only with a soak run. Verified against the
// build noted below.

session token of bawif-hahog = htk6_ac5981